Product Overview

This heavy-duty accumulator cup diaphragm is tailor-made for AMPA3000, AMPA4000, AMPA5000 series hydraulic rock breakers, the core energy-isolating spare part for breaker nitrogen accumulators widely equipped on medium & large excavators and mining construction machinery. It integrates integrated piston cup and reinforced diaphragm one-piece molding, fully isolates high-pressure nitrogen chamber and hydraulic oil circuit.

Adopted imported high-performance modified HNBR + fabric reinforced composite material, it features outstanding fatigue resistance, high temperature resistance, oil resistance and anti-explosion performance. Direct OEM replacement for original AMPA breaker diaphragm, effectively solving common failures including nitrogen leakage, impact power drop, accumulator failure and frequent oil temperature rise, greatly extending breaker service life under continuous high-frequency crushing operation.
